 Silver without stones rings – plain rings or solid silver rings. Rings are produced from the smallest sizes to the most massive – so-called “armors" which cover the finger lengthwise. Rings should be chosen according to personal taste. Simple solid rings, rather than more decorative are commonly worn for normal situations. For formal purposes, wear more intricately knotted, strikingly designed rings with patterns. The best way is to combine two dominant, intricate rings and add some finer additional ones. In case a color combination is needed, use enamel rings.

 Taxpayers are likely to lose most of the $81 billion that Congress and the administration sunk into the two companies, according to the Congressional Oversight Panel. Chrysler is expected to lose all $14.3 billion of the taxpayers' money. The daily management of Chrysler is controlled by Fiat which owns 20% of the U.S. company with options which could take that amount to 35%. Fiat has not put any money into Chrysler, so if the American firm becomes a significant operational or management burden there are very few reason for the Italian company, which has sales troubles of its own in Europe, to stay long term. Fiat lost $254 million in the second quarter, so its board may eventually believe that Chrysler is a distraction and one without a future. What Chrysler needs most from Fiat is money.
